Kevin Jepsen (triceps) has been cleared to throw his first bullpen session on Saturday.
Jepsen has extended his long toss program in recent weeks to build up his arm strength, and hasn’t experienced any setbacks. He had been experiencing tightness in his triceps since the second week of spring training, and attempted to pitch through the ailment. He struggled through his first six outings however, and hit the disabled list on April 13. He should return to the Angels bullpen by the end of the month.
